Team Update: Round 6 v Warriors

Craig Bellamy has named his 19-man squad for Sunday’s Round 6 fixture against the New Zealand Warriors at a sold-out AAMI Park.

Lazarus Vaalepu, Sua Fa'alogo and Keagan Russell-Smith drop out of the 22-man squad named on Tuesday, with Joe Chan and Kane Bradley named on the extended bench.
